What companies run services between Rayong, Thailand and Phrom Phong BTS Station, Thailand?

Rayong Tour operates a bus from Rayong Bus Terminal 2 to Bangkok Bus Terminal Eakamai every 3 hours. Tickets cost ฿180–270 and the journey takes 2h 35m.
